The facilities belong to Lukoil-Nizhnevolzhskneft.
Drones of the Security Service of Ukraine have struck again at Russian oil production platforms in the Caspian Sea. As a result of the attack, production processes have been suspended, RBC-Ukraine reported, citing sources in the SBU.
Long-range drones of the SBU's Alpha Special Operations Center have successfully attacked the oil production platform named after V.V. Vakhtangov in the Caspian Sea for the second time this week. In addition, another platform - named after Korchagin - was hit. Korchagin. Both facilities belong to Lukoil-Nizhnevolzhskneft and operate in the Caspian Sea.
According to preliminary information, the SBU drones damaged critical equipment on both ice-resistant platforms, which led to the suspension of production processes.
The Filanovsky oil field is the largest oil production platform in the Caspian Sea. The Filanovsky field is one of the largest explored fields in Russia and in the Russian sector of the Caspian Sea. Its reserves are estimated at 129 million tons of oil and 30 billion cubic meters of gas.
"The SBU continues systematic work aimed at reducing revenues to the Russian budget from the oil and gas sector. The frequency, geography and accuracy of the strikes is a signal to the Russian Federation that as long as its aggression continues, 'bavovna' will burn at all Russian facilities that work for the war," an informed source in the SBU said."
